Lee masSe encontró patología cerebral compatible con DFT en aproximadamente 35% de los casos de enfermedad de la neurona motora en un estudio reciente
According to a recent study published in the research journal Brain, brain pathology consistent with FTD was detected in roughly 35% of the participants with motor neuron disease, which includes diseases like ALS. Abnormal protein clumps were detected in 90% of the samples studied, with participants classified as having both FTD and motor neuron disease…
Lee masLa prometedora terapia génica para la DFT de AviadoBio aparece en el periódico británico The Guardian.
In London’s Docklands, British biotech company AviadoBio is developing a promising gene therapy to treat FTD. The Guardian wrote about the company’s progress on June 13. AviadoBio’s lead therapy, AVB-101, targets the specific genetic form FTD-GRN, caused by mutations that create a deficiency in progranulin, a protein essential for healthy brain cells.
